Overview
At Chemistry from East Tennessee State University the students must pass a comprehensive exam in the division of their thesis concentration. They are also required to conduct thesis research, write it, present it in a seminar, and defend an oral exam. All graduate level and special topics courses are offered in the evenings.
Careers
The program is designed, through advanced courses and individual research, to prepare the student for a career as a chemist or for continued study in a rigorous doctoral program.

General requirements
- A b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university with an adequate undergraduate background for the advanced work in the chemistry department.
- This background must include a course in Physical Chemistry with laboratory requiring calculus as a prerequisite.
- At least two recommendation letters from individuals who can comment on the academic as well as personal qualifications of the applicant.
- Unofficial transcripts may be submitted with your application. Official transcripts will be required upon acceptance to a Graduate program.
- 3.0 (on a 4.0 scale)
- A statement about why you wish to pursue this degree.
- Prerequisite course in Physical Chemistry requiring calculus, with laboratory
